Whaley's toilets are unacceptable

WHALEY Bridge's public toilets are going down the pan, according to town councillors.

The poor condition of the Market Street conveniences was discussed at a recent meeting of Whaley Bridge Town Council.

The authority also wrote to High Peak Borough Council to highlight the inadequate lighting, dirty floors and appalling condition of the toilets, and demanded they be brought up to an acceptable standard ahead of the tourist season.

Cllr John Haken, the Executive Member for the Environment, responded to town councillors' concerns at their April meeting last week, stating the toilets would be cleaned and that a report was to be prepared into their current condition.

* Whaley Bridge and Furness Vale residents are being invited to raise any concerns they have about the community with their Safer Neighbourhood team.

A meeting will be held on Wednesday April 22, at the Mechanics Institute between 7pm and 9pm, for local people, partner organisations, businesses and community representatives to discuss and decide upon policing priorities for the area.

There will also be a chance to meet local officers and receive an update on what they have been targeting during previous months.
